So… what’s it like to publish a book? This presentation takes students through my pathway to publication; from writing to publishing to rejection. Intended to give students an insight into what it takes to get a piece of writing out of your head into something that can be bought at a bookstore, borrowed from the library, or downloaded online, this presentation gets the audience excited about books! Trouble in the Trees. If Bree wants to keep climbing, she’ll have to go out on a limb. Bree is happiest when she’s climbing the trees at Cedar Grove, her urban townhouse complex. She’s the best climber around, but when one of her younger friends falls from a tree and hurts himself, the Neighborhood Council bans all tree climbing in Cedar Grove.
